## Onboarding — Halloway Audio Guide

Releases for the Halloway museum guide app ship Tuesdays. The release manager signs builds with the gallery key, stored offline. If the signing laptop is reimaged, restore the key from escrow. Escrow restore prompts for the phrase that appears below.

vault phrase of bagaf-kajeg = jorath-feniel-briir-siliel-ralix

Ticket: Config drift causing slow cold starts — Fenlark Functions

External plugin handlers on Fenlark are cold-starting 3–4x slower in the eu-shard than elsewhere. Root cause appears to be configuration drift: the shard's provisioner was never updated after the memory-tier change, so handlers initialize with mismatched pool sizes. Plugin authors should not work around this in code; we will reconcile centrally. For transparency, the drifted shard is currently running with the values below.

service settings:
novath:
  pin: 1396
  tenant: pelys
  seal: seal_ccc035e1
  metrics_host: metrics.novath.qorvelworks.test
  standby_team: fraeth
  escalation: drueth-zorok
  nonce: 61d508

### Escalation — Sweepster Orphan Cleanup

If Sweepster flags more than 500 orphaned volumes in one pass, don't panic — it's usually a stale tag filter, not an actual leak. Pause the sweep with `sweepster halt`, snapshot the candidate list, and ping the infra channel. If the list includes anything tagged `release-locked`, that's a hard stop: nothing gets deleted until the Calderon Cloud platform leads sign off. For sign-off requests or anything you can't untangle within an hour, email the sweeper owners.

alerts address for kafog-haweg: wendor.ulaael@zemvarworks.internal

Capacity note for the Bramblewick export retry queue. Failed exports are requeued with exponential backoff, and the queue depth is our main capacity signal: sustained depth above the high-water mark means downstream Pellis storage is saturated, not that we need more workers. As the new contractor, please don't raise worker counts without checking storage latency first — it usually makes things worse. Retry timing, backoff caps, and the high-water threshold are all driven by the constants shown below.

limits module of yagef-bajog:
TIERS = {
    "druael": 370,
    "tamix": 286,
    "pelius": 541,
    "pelael": 78,
    "pelox": 47,
    "ralath": 533,
    "drumir": 801,
}